Start iTunes on your Computer it should automatically start. After iTunes opens, click on the Phone icon which you should be able to see just below the iTunes top Menu bar See image below.

Once you click on the phone icon you will see iTunes Settings Menu on your screen. Next, click on the Summary tab in the iTunes Settings Menu in case you are not already on that tab. While on Summary tab, look for the section labelled Backups and select iCloud as the backup option See image above and click on Done button located at the bottom right of your screen.
